Very interesting fusion of Korean and Mexican cuisine. I was impressed with everything we tried, and really found that there was a perfect balance between the two cultures. There's a daily special coming out of the smoker, and we were lucky enough to get the pork ribs on our visit. Tender, smoky and meaty. We also opted for the grilled calamari on a bed of kimchi, braised shortrib tacos, fried fish tacos with kimchi slaw, and the carnitas pork tacos with bulgogi spice. We were extremely happy with everything, although some of the spice levels were a little high for a few of the diners. Fresh, flavorful, and fun. Definitely worth checking out if you're looking for something new.
